What is the meaning of byline?
The byline (or by-line in British English) on a newssignNow or magazine article gives the name of the writer of the article. ... Dictionary.com defines a byline as "a printed line of text accompanying a news story, article, or the like, giving the author's name". -

What is difference between headline and byline?
When used as nouns, byline means a line at the head of a newssignNow or magazine article carrying the writer's name, whereas headline means the heading or title of a magazine or newssignNow article. -

hi everyone the seventh edition of APA style specifies two different ways to set up your paper one for students and one for professionals this video will walk you through how to set up a paper for students so this is ideal for assignments for a class whether you are in high school college or even graduate school but if you are writing a paper that you plan to submit for publication in a journal check the video description for a link to the professional version which is a little bit different the video description also contains timestamps that will jump you to various parts of the video so if you are just looking for one thing in particular use the timestamps to get there now in this video I will demonstrate everything using Microsoft Word on a Windows computer if you are using word for mac an older version of word or a different word processing program entirely like Google Docs your paper should still look the same way but the menu options you select to make that happen might be in a different spot additionally in order to get the most use out of this video I recommend pausing the video as needed to complete the steps yourself because there is a lot to go over I will demonstrate and talk any moderate pace if that is too fast for you listen for a bit pause the video rewind is needed get caught up and then continue and as a final note in some spots I'm going to use lorem ipsum text or placeholder text for illustrative purposes now the very first thing I recommend doing is to enable the formatting symbols these are normally invisible but I find them to be extremely useful when writing and formatting papers because they show every keystroke that you make to do that click on the paragraph symbol which is the show/hide formatting marks button now whenever you press Enter tab or space symbols for each will appear these symbols are not printed so you do not need to worry about a bunch of extra stuff appearing on what you do submit it might take you a little bit of time to get used to seeing them but once you do you won't ever turn them off now to actually get to APA style the first step is to ensure that your page margins are set up correctly APA style specifies 1-inch page margins on all sides this is the default option nowadays but older of word and other word processing programs may have different margins to double check go to layout margins and then see what is selected as you can see normal is the default option one inch on all sides if you need to change your margins you can pick one of the presets or just go to custom margins and you can then go ahead and change top left bottom right to one inch each next we...
